Chocolate dip vs Chocolate candy with dried fruit: nutrition compared

Nutrient (per 100 g)Chocolate dipChocolate candy with dried fruit
Calories393 kcal390 kcal
Protein3.3 g4.1 g
Carbohydrates65.3 g68.4 g
Fat13.2 g14.8 g
Fibre2 g3.1 g
Sugar45.5 g62.2 g
Sodium289 mg36 mg

All values per 100 g. Source: USDA FoodData Central.

Chocolate dip provides 393 kcal per 100 g, with 3.3 g of protein, 65.3 g of carbohydrates and 13.2 g of fat. 1 tbsp of Chocolate dip (20 g) provides about 79 kcal.

Calories per portion

PortionWeightCalories
1 tbsp20 g79 kcal
1 individual container70 g275 kcal
100 g100 g393 kcal

Portion weights: USDA FoodData Central

About Chocolate dip

Chocolate dip is a delicious and versatile treat that typically consists of melted chocolate combined with various ingredients to enhance flavor and texture. Originating from ancient Mesoamerican cultures, where cacao was revered, chocolate has transformed over centuries into a beloved indulgence worldwide, especially in desserts and snacks. Chocolate dip can be made from various types of chocolate, including dark, milk, and white, allowing for a range of flavors and sweetness levels that cater to different palates. Nutritionally, chocolate dip offers a rich source of energy, primarily from carbohydrates and fats. With approximately 393 calories per 100g, it contains 3.30g of protein, 65.30g of carbohydrates, and 13.20g of fats. This unique combination makes it an excellent choice for enhancing fruits, pastries, and snack boards. However, moderation is key due to its high-calorie content, and it can be enjoyed as an occasional treat rather than a daily staple.
